Fixes critical P0 issue where animation-tokens.json wasn't consumed by the
generate command, breaking the value chain. The animation extraction system
now properly flows through: animation-extract → tokens → generate → prototypes.
Changes:
- Added animation-extract command with hybrid CSS extraction + interactive
fallback strategy
- Updated generate.md to load and inject animation tokens into prototypes
- Added CSS animation support (custom properties, keyframes, interactions,
accessibility)
- Integrated animation extraction into explore-auto and imitate-auto workflows

- Convert all .sh files from CRLF to LF line endings
- Add .gitattributes to enforce LF for shell scripts
- Fix "bash\r: No such file or directory" error in WSL environments
This resolves the installation failure on WSL/Linux systems where
Windows CRLF line endings cause shell scripts to fail.
